Just thought i'd give a heads up to anyone thinking about this case. I have had it about a week now and was very pleased with it. The fit is great and the quality feels good as well. I took my ipad out of the case for the first time last night and was met with a nasty surprise. The black dye from the case seems to have rubbed off onto the back of my ipad. Luckily i have a sgp back protector on it so it didn't actually get onto the ipad itself. Not very pleased as the ipad is less than 2 weeks old and the sgp is less than 1 week. I would have been really upset if i didnt have the sgp. I have tried rubbing it off with a couple different things but nothing is working.
